What It Really Means

An instant payout online casino promises near-immediate withdrawals to your chosen payment method. That can mean a transfer in seconds or within a few hours, rather than the typical 24–72 hours many sites require. The speed depends on the casino’s processing, the payment rails it uses, and any verification checks it performs.

How It Works in Practice

Behind the marketing, the process usually follows a few common steps:

  • Player requests a withdrawal through their account.
  • The casino runs security checks: identity verification, payment method checks, and bonus-related conditions.
  • If approved, the casino sends the funds through a fast payment channel such as an e-wallet, cryptocurrency, or instant bank transfer.
  • The payment processor or bank completes the transfer to your account.

Not all payment methods are instant. E-wallets and crypto typically deliver funds faster than traditional bank transfers, so an instant payout online casino may limit fast options to certain wallets or crypto accounts.

Limits and Things to Watch

Fast payouts are attractive, but there are trade-offs and common pitfalls:

  • Verification delays: if your ID, address, or payment method isn’t verified, the casino may still hold payouts pending checks.
  • Payment fees: some instant transfers carry fees from processors or intermediary services.
  • Withdrawal caps: casinos sometimes limit how much you can withdraw instantly per transaction or per day.
  • Promotional conditions: bonuses often come with wagering requirements that can delay or deny a withdrawal until conditions are met.

Always check the terms before assuming speed equals simplicity.

What to Check Before You Start

Before you sign up at an instant payout online casino, verify these items:

  • Licensing and regulation: confirm the casino is licensed by a recognized regulator and follows anti-money-laundering rules.
  • Accepted payment methods: look for e-wallets or crypto if you want the fastest transfers.
  • Verification policy: see what documents are required and upload them early to avoid delays.
  • Fees and limits: check withdrawal minimums, maximums, and whether instant transfers cost extra.
  • Customer support reputation: fast payouts work best when support responds quickly to any problems.

Costs, Fees, and Payment Notes

Instant payouts are not always free. Casinos sometimes absorb fees, but processors or banks may charge. Typical fees include fixed withdrawal fees, percentage-based charges for currency conversion, or third-party processing fees for rapid transfers. Also note that exchange rates can affect the final amount if you withdraw in a different currency.

Budget for small fees when choosing speed over cost. If minimizing fees matters more than time, a slower bank transfer might be cheaper.

FAQs

Q1: Are instant payouts guaranteed at all casinos?

A1: No. Instant payouts depend on the casino’s processing system, your payment method, and whether your account passes verification checks. Even casinos that advertise instant withdrawals may delay a payment for compliance or fraud checks.

Q2: Which payment methods usually deliver the fastest withdrawals?

A2: E-wallets and many cryptocurrencies are typically the fastest options, often completing transfers within minutes or hours. Instant bank transfers are fast too wintinoplay.com but can vary by country and bank processing policies.

Q3: Will instant withdrawals cost more in fees?

A3: Sometimes. Casinos or payment processors may charge fees for rapid transfers, and currency conversion can add cost. Always check the casino’s withdrawal fee schedule before choosing instant payout options.

Q4: What should I do if a promised instant payout is delayed?

A4: Contact customer support and provide any requested verification documents. Check the casino’s terms for reasons payouts are held, and escalate to the regulator if you suspect unfair treatment after following the site’s procedures.

Q5: Is it safer to pick slower withdrawals over instant ones?

A5: Speed does not equal safety. A reputable, licensed casino with slower bank transfers can be safer than an unregulated site offering instant payouts. Focus first on regulation and transparency, then on speed and fees.
